Download Update Yes No Field In Access Sql
Download update yes no field in access sql. SQL does not store T or F in a bit column. It sounds like it is a varchar or char data type. If this conversion is in an Access table where you are importing the data you will have to add a bit field (Yes/No) and then update it using an IIF statement.
A logical field can be displayed as Yes/No, True/False, or On/Off. In code, use the constants True and False (equivalent to -1 and 0). Note: Null values are not allowed in Yes/No fields. Sorry, don't have a copy of access handy to try this out. I use Update Query to update the STUDENT field that has Yes/NO data type. I my case I would like to update the STUDENT field to "blank” (don’t have any Yes or NO in the STUDENT field).
It works well if I use """ with the text field, but it didn't work for the YES NO field. Thank you, Chi. The lock field is a Yes/No data type.
The query uses a TempVar to filter to only records with the proper incidentNumber, and then it is supposed to use the fldLock to only update records where the Yes/No is NOT checked, i.e. is False. When I actually run the query, the fldLock filter isn't working.
The YESNO datatype in Access is -1 for true, and 0 for false. However, the values true and false should work. If this was the problem I would expect you to be getting a datatype mismatch error.
Syntax error is different. To set the Format property for Yes/No fields in Access, simply select the logical field in the table design grid. Then click into the “Format” property in the field properties section and select a choice from the drop-down menu available. Set Yes/No field -- Microsoft Access VBA. This is a basic question. I would like to use the conditions on a form to change a Yes/No field on a table when the user click Ok on the form.
' Create SQL statement to specifying the update query. UPDATE does not generate a result set. Also, after you update records using an update query, you cannot undo the operation. If you want to know which records were updated, first examine the results of a select query that uses the same criteria, and then run the update query. Maintain backup copies of your data at all times.
From the Access designer, you can interactively create a query and specify its type: Update Query Option when Designing Queries in MS Access and Update Query Option when Designing Queries in MS Access and Update Queries let you modify the values of a field or fields.
Hi Experts. I have converted a customer's MS Access MDB Database to n SQL Server Database. All went well except the MS Access Yes/No fields that was converted to the SQL Server Database's Bit datatypes.
I expected that the Yes/No (MS Access) would translate directly to SQL Server 1 (True) and 0 (False). An Access Yes/No data type corresponds to the SQL Server BIT data type.
In Access TRUE is -1 and FALSE is 0; in SQL Server, TRUE is 1 and FALSE is 0. In Access, if you don't provide a default value for a Yes/No field, it will be always be displayed as FALSE. In SQL Server, if you don't specify a default, the default value is NULL. Access creates a relationship between those fields in the two tables and uses that relationship to join any related records.
On the Design tab, in the Query Type group, click Update. In the destination table, double-click the fields that you want to update. Each field appears in the Field row in. I think the equivalent to yes/no in Access is a BIT field.
You could also use a INT field. If you decide to use a BIT field don't forget to set the default value to 0 or 1. The field that is in both tables would be the telephone number. If the phone number is in the HistoricalCustomers table, then I would like to update a field called HistCustContacts in the CustomerContacts table with a 'Y' if it is in the table or a 'N' if it is not in the table. I have yes/no in one access table field. run query and can get records with yes, or No by putting =yes, or =no in the query criterai.
Now the question is, if I put a? mark in the query criteria and run query and then put Yes, or No in the Enter Parameter Value window it doesn't work. any ideasd. Hello, My problem is about 3 checkboxes that I want to link to 3 yes/no fields in my database. I want to update some information and when I check/uncheck the checkbox in my ASP page I want to check/uncheck the yes/no fields.
To update all the records in a table, specify the table name, and then use the SET clause to specify the field or fields to be changed. UPDATE tblCustomers SET Phone = 'None' In most cases, you will want to qualify the UPDATE statement with a WHERE clause to limit the number of records changed.
Using Access front end; SQL Server Back end: I have a complex form that has lots of data fields including about thirty or so checkboxes storing Yes/No data that I would like my users to be able to use the Filter by Form functionality with to create a "Custom" query.
This works perfectly fine when I filter on a text field. Also, this. Use IIf in a query. The IIf function is frequently used to create calculated fields in queries.
The syntax is the same, with the exception that in a query, you must preface the expression with a field alias and a colon (:) instead of an equal sign (=).To use the preceding example, you would type the following in the Field row of the query design grid. Now no matter what I use, true/false, yes/no, it doesn't matter, it does NOT pick up the records.
I've done if statements for if the checkbox is checked then value = yes and then run a SQL statment where reported = value. I've tried using true/false.
It doesn't matter. It always returns false. What the heck does SQL read a yes/no field as? Any field that has No selected next to indexed, means there is no index for that given field.
You can change that by clicking on the drop-down menu and choosing the other two options — Yes (Duplicate OK) and Yes (No duplicates). The last option Yes (No Duplicates) means that Access will automatically prohibit duplicate values in that field. hi, i need to create a yes/no field in a SQL Server database table. I know that i could previously do this in Microsoft Access and i believe that SQL Server now uses Boolean(0 or 1) for this.
Does anyone have any ideas as to how to convert these 0 or 1 to yes or no with a default of yes? I am If you want yes/no you either have to transform the. Now, select your bit (Yes/No) field. At the bottom of the window in the 'Field Properties' area, click on the 'Lookup' tab. You're going to see a property called 'Display Control'.
Change this to 'Check Box'. Now close the table, and click 'Yes' to save your changes. It really is that simple. Notice also that the literal “Yes” fills up a column named HasActiveOrder. As for the customers who have ever ordered a certain line of product, let’s assume the product line is in a class field in an item master file, and that the items a customer has ordered are in the sales order details file.
Logical, Boolean, Yes/No or Bit Data Types in SQL. Some things in life are black and white, and the bit data type is one of them: there are no shades of grey, let alone 50 (I've been wanting to sneak that reference into a blog on computer training for ages). What a Bit Data Type Represents. Most applications have a specific data type for coping with things which can only have one of two states.
Then i want to display this field as a checkbox in a report. I know access uses 0 for yes and -1 for no in the case of check boxes, so i tried this in the expression builder: IIf([field1] = [Field2], 0, -1) made sense to me, but when this field is set as the source for a checkbox it is always checked even when the data differs.
I have a checkbox in one of my tables and I need for it to update using an update query. Now using straight Access I can just say UPDATE hcmx.mgshmso.ruoxfiled=Yes or even -1 and I get the good result. The problem is I am using ome VBA coding and it doesn't seem to like the =Yes or = Field in table with data type as yes/no.
If I create a query with condition to show either 'yes' or 'no' for this field. For the time being, I have to put either "='yes' or '=no' in the condition to accomplish my query. According to my knowledge, I could create a list box filed instead of. Then either double-click or drag-drop your Yes/no field into the first Field cell in the tabl-like grid. Change the query from the default Select query type to an Update query, via either the Query menu, the query type icon on the query design toolbar, or the QueryType option on the right-click menu in the top section of the QBE window.
AutoNumber fields automatically give each record its own number, usually starting at 1: 4 bytes: Date/Time: Use for dates and times: 8 bytes: Yes/No: A logical field can be displayed as Yes/No, True/False, or On/Off. In code, use the constants True and False (equivalent to -1 and 0). Note: Null values are not allowed in Yes/No fields: 1 bit. Converting Yes/No, Access Field To SQL. I did create the field on table as TinyInt.
I created an appending query and appended the records to the SQL table. Now I have 0's or 's in the field.
but it seems to only allow UPDATE if there are no joined tables. I found the same thing in Stored Procedures, the SQL designer would. In this tutorial, we will learn how to create a query in Access with a Yes or No hcmx.mgshmso.ru't forget to check out our site hcmx.mgshmso.ru for more fre. SQL HOME SQL Intro SQL Syntax SQL Select SQL Select Distinct SQL Where SQL And, Or, Not SQL Order By SQL Insert Into SQL Null Values SQL Update SQL Delete SQL Select Top SQL Min and Max SQL Count, Avg, Sum SQL Like SQL Wildcards SQL In SQL Between SQL Aliases SQL Joins SQL Inner Join SQL Left Join SQL Right Join SQL Full Join SQL Self Join SQL.
MS Access MS Access Forms 3 responses on “ MS Access – Forms – Yes/No option Group with Null State ” Verona February 8, at am. Oh my goodness! Thank you for explaining this.
I’ve been sitting at my desk for the past 4 hours trying to figure out what was wrong with my yes or no. We are converting a large Delphi app from Access to SQL Server. SQL does not accept True / False for the BIT fields - it wants 1 or 0. As in: UPDATE ABC SET FLAG=TRUE We may have a lot to change if all these need to change to UPDATE ABC SET FLAG=1 Any ideas on a workaround for this?
(In Access, these were Yes/No fields which got converted to Bit.). How to Update Data with RecordSet in MS Access You can update the existing record using a recordset. However, the recordset type must not be a snapshot or record is locked. For example, there is a record when the user logged in database.
We want to record a logout Time when the user logged out from database. We will capture the logged out time on the last form that is closed. Code: Update. Working with Yes/No Fields. You use Yes/No fields in tables when you have a quantity that you can represent in one of two states: on (Yes, True, or -1) or off (No, False, or 0). When you create a Yes/No field in the table Design view, the Display Control property (it's in the Lookup tab) defaults to Check hcmx.mgshmso.ru means that when you add a Yes/No field to a form, Access automatically.
If so, I’ll show you the steps to sum values in Access using SQL. Steps to Sum Values in Access using SQL Step 1: Create a Table. To start, create a table in Access. For example, I created a table (called ‘supplies‘) in Access: The ultimate goal is to get the sum of all the values under the ‘Cost‘ column. Step 2: Write the SQL Query. First, specify the table name that you want to change data in the UPDATE clause. Second, assign a new value for the column that you want to update.
In case you want to update data in multiple columns, each column = value pair is separated by a comma (,). Third, specify which rows you want to update. Yes you can, however I would start with something in SQL get this working and sort out the logic then trnaspose this to access. so on SQL the syntax would be UDPATE tablename set field = '' where field2 = 'test' get all your logic in here and post back. then you need to do some 'clever' stuff to get this to work in access.
You can write and execute SQL statements in Access, but you have to use a back-door method to do it. To open a basic editor where you can enter SQL code, follow these steps: 1 Open your database and click the CREATE tab. This will display the ribbon across the top of the window. Sometimes, we may want to encrypt a SQL Server column data, such as a credit card number.
In this blog, let's learn how we can encrypt and decrypt SQL Server column data in the database itself. I don't think there is straight way to make the field return Yes/No. In your workflow, you need to create a workflow variable, check whether the field is true or false and assign variable with Yes or No.
Use the variable in your e-mail activity. Yes No field in Access is either -1, 0 no nulls. I have had success by passing a non null tiny int/small int to an access Yes/No field if it is already pre-exisiting. For table creation with an access Yes/No field, I pass thru a DDL statement to access to create the table then populate it with non null -1,0 values as neccessary for Yes/No True.
Summary: in this tutorial, you will learn how to use the SQL ADD COLUMN clause of the ALTER TABLE statement to add one or more columns to an existing table. Overview of SQL ADD COLUMN clause.
To add a new column to a table, you use the ALTER TABLE ADD COLUMN statement as follows. In MS - SQL there is no Yes/No data type. The type should be bit and the values are 1 or 0. When you load the source database into a DataSet object a Yes/No source field is stored in a field of a DataTable object as DataType of hcmx.mgshmso.run and you should check it like here. a different name for each checkbox, and have a different field in your database (to store the on/off or yes/no or whatever) for each of the checkboxes.
It's a little extra DB work that makes the programming a lot easier. if var = "on" then var = "yes" else var = "no" end if SQL - insert into table (field1) values (" & var & ")".